Rafael,
Right now, we don't have an action for logging in or registering. We're looking into the possibility of adding such an action, but we need to verify with Facebook that that's a legitimate type of thing to post into a user's Timeline. There are some things that they don't want being posted on behalf of a user because it's not 'important' actions.

We do like the idea though, and would love to have a plugin for that in the future.

You have to click the "Edit Settings" link to see the Open Graph options in your app.

For reading an article, you should use either the Open Graph - Content or Open Graph - K2 plugins. You can see the full Open Graph Actions for Joomla configuration guide.
